Richard Pryor was actually set to star as the Sheriff however the movie studio refused due to Richard's controversial image in those days. Would've been amazing however Cleavon Little delivered an unforgettable performance as Sheriff Bart.

2023-09-06 06:02:08 +0000 UTCHedy Lamar was an actress during the golden age of Hollywood and an inventor. She’s been called the Mother of the Wi Fi because of her development of frequency hopping technology for Allied torpedoes. It was used to defeat the threat of jamming by the Axis powers
